Do you mean the actual Tekken characters of the games? If they are available from any other source than the owners of the games (and its content) then I'd be very surprised because it would be a copyright/trademark violation
Ah yeah, I see there might be some free models available somewhere. But you said to buy them and that is where the copyright/trademark violation comes in Nobody other than the legal owner is allowed to sell them. Even freely sharing them is a slippery slope. It's more that the legal owners often condone the free distribution of their characters (it's kind of free advertising I suppose), rather than that it is legally allowed. Reproduction is usually prohibited, in any form or using any method.
Also, if you are going to use them in commercial works then you'd be in trouble. If it's for personal work then there's less of a problem.
